JRL calls for shutdown on March 24 against ban on JeI, JKLF

INS Correspondent by INS Correspondent
March 23, 2019
A A
Share on FacebookShare on TwitterWhatsappTelegramEmail

Srinagar: Joint Resistance leadership has called for a state wide shutdown on Sunday against the government’s order of banning Jammu and Kashmir Liberation Front and Jamat e Islami.

The spokesman said that shutdown should be observed on March 24 against ‘oppressive measures by the Government’.

JRL comprises on Syed Ali Geelani, Mirwaiz Umar Farooq and Yasin Malik.

Malik has been slapped with PSA and is serving detention Kotbalwal Jail in Jammu.
